Non-Supersymmetric Attractors in Symmetric Coset Spaces

We present a method of constructing generic single-centered and multi-centered extremal black hole solutions in a large class of 4D N=2 supergravities coupled to vector-multiplets with cubic prepotentials. The method is applicable to models for which the 3D moduli spaces obtained via c*-map are symmetric coset spaces. The attractor solutions are generated by certain nilpotent elements in the coset algebra. We present explicit computations in 4D N=2 supergravity coupled to one vector-multiplet, whose 3D moduli space is the symmetric coset space G_{2(2)}/SL(2,R)^2. The non-supersymmetric multi-centered black holes in this model are found to lack the intricate moduli space of bound configurations that are typical of the supersymmetric case.
